Default WPT Foxwoods Main Event Hand

My image: I've played at this table for about an hour or so and have only raised twice after others have entered the pot. The first was a button raise to 1100 after a few 200 limps and get a BB call and UTG+1 limp reraises allin for 2500 more and I fold.

The second was a CO raise after 1 limp. Button calls, limper folds and I end up doubling with AK vs A3 when an A flops and the money goes in on the turn.

I've been about the 3rd tightest player at the table and have 10K chips.

Villain read: About average tight at the table and has not shown down any garbage. But he's certainly raising enough that he doesn't have monsters every time.

Table read: I'm now sandwiched between Young Phan and Michael Gracz and there's only one weak spot at the table - a weak tight guy with a short stack. Outplaying this table isn't likely.

The hand: Blinds 100-200, Ante 25. Tourney avg stk - 16 K. (about 250 left out of 410 in this flight.) Villain (18.5 K) opens to 625 3 off the button and Young Phan (30-35 K) calls in CO. I have AKo on the button and reraise to 2700. Folds to villain, who goes allin. Young thinks and thinks before finally folding.

Action to me. I'm not the best at reading souls, but I can't see him making a move with nada here. If I fold I have 7300 left. What's my move?
